Chhattisgarh Birth & Baptism Records

British India Births and Baptisms (1710-1960)

Digital images, searchable by a name and place index, of registers recording over 700,000 baptisms in British India. They comprise largely of baptisms performed in Anglican and Presbyterian churches, but include records of other faiths, such as Catholic and Armenian Apostolic.

European Births and Baptisms in India (1786-1947)

An index of baptisms from European churches in India. The records typically record the child's name, date of birth & baptism, and parents' names. Original records can be viewed at the British Library or LDS centres.

British Civil Service Evidence of Age Index (1752-1948)

An index to evidences provided to the British Civil Service Commission to establish the age of prospective and current civil servants. The index includes date & place of birth and provides a reference to surviving documents.

Foreign and Overseas Registers of British Subjects (1627-1965)

Registers of births/baptisms, marriages and deaths/burials containing over 160,000 entries from over 30 countries. These largely relate to British subjects.

British Nationals Born Overseas (1818-2006)

An index to births of British citizens born overseas that were registered with the British Consul or High Commissioner. Provides a reference that can be used to order a birth certificate.

Chhattisgarh Marriage & Divorce Records

British India Marriages (1710-1983)

Digital images, searchable by a name and place index, of registers recording over 450,000 marriages in British India. They comprise largely of marriages performed in Anglican and Presbyterian churches, but include records of other faiths, such as Catholic and Armenian Apostolic.

European Marriages in India (1792-1948)

An index to marriages solemnised in European churches in India. The records typically record the date of marriage, names of those to be wed and their father's names. Original records can be viewed at the British Library or LDS centres.

Chhattisgarh Death & Burial Records

British India Deaths and Burials (1710-1959)

Digital images, searchable by a name and place index, of registers recording over 450,000 burials in British India. They comprise largely of burials recorded by Anglican and Presbyterian churches, but include records of other faiths, such as Catholic and Armenian Apostolic.

European Deaths and Burials in India (1719-1948)

An index of burials registered by European churches in India. They typically record the name of the deceased, date of death and date of burial. Original records can be viewed at the British Library or LDS centres.

Chhattisgarh Wills & Probate Records

British India Wills & Probate (1774-1948)

Digital images of wills, inventories, administrations and other probate documents of residents of the Indian Empire. The documents can be searched by a name and place index. They relate largely to British subjects, but also contain other Europeans, Indians, Jews etc.

Prerogative Court of Canterbury Wills (PPV) (1384-1858)

A index to testators whose will was proved in the Prerogative Court of Canterbury. They principally cover those who lived in the lower two thirds of Britain, but contain wills for residents of Scotland, Ireland, British India and other countries. A copy of each will may be purchased for digital download.

Chhattisgarh Occupation & Business Records

East India Company & Civil Service Pensions (1762-1947)

Registers recording pension applications and payments for the British East India Company and the Civil Service in British India. Can contain details on the pensioner, their family, marriages, deaths, births and other details. Contains digital images of the registers.

Crockford's Clerical Directories (1868-1914)

Brief biographies of Anglican clergy in the UK.

East India Register and Directory (1855)

A list of the servants of the East India Company, including civilians, military and marine personnel, European residents and mariners with interests in India. This is a searchable database, linked to digital images of the book.

East India Company Pensions (1793-1833)

Contains the name, rank, when the pension was granted, rate and source of annual pension, the period the pension was granted and the grounds on which the pension was granted for East India Company employees. Contains digital images of the registers.

India Office List (1933)

A directory of the civil service of the Government of India and military, including the dates of appointment, promotions and qualifications, recipients of medals and awards. Includes the rules and regulations of the Civil Service.
